Ticketmaster Implements Price Cap for Resale Tickets

Ticketmaster has initiated the removal of resale tickets for Ontario events to adhere to a new provincial law that limits the price of such tickets to face value. According to Ticketmaster’s spokesperson, Shabnum Durrani, customers will have the opportunity to repost their tickets next week once the resale marketplace is updated. Durrani emphasized Ticketmaster’s commitment to establishing a fair and secure ticket marketplace in compliance with all relevant laws and regulations, with the company already informing customers of the adjustments.

This action follows the passing of a budget bill by the Ontario government, which included the imposition of a price cap on resale tickets. The bill received royal assent recently. The decision to implement the price cap stemmed from consumer grievances regarding tickets for high-demand events, like last year’s World Series and Taylor Swift’s Eras tour, being acquired by resellers and resold at inflated prices.

Updates to the 2017 Ticket Sales Act were announced by the government last month, prompted by the Premier’s pledge to review legislation due to the exorbitant resale prices of World Series tickets in Toronto. Notably, despite previous opposition, the law change has led StubHub and SeatGeek, two prominent resale platforms, to express intentions to comply with the regulations.

While certain events, such as the FIFA World Cup in Toronto, were initially expected to be exempt from the resale cap, a spokesperson clarified that the cap would indeed apply to the sporting event. The immediate enforcement of the price cap was emphasized by Stephen Crawford’s press secretary, Giulia Paikin, who stated that FIFA would not be granted any exemptions.

StubHub conveyed concerns over the price cap’s potential negative impact on fans, citing a potential increase in ticket fraud. SeatGeek similarly expressed reservations about the legislation but committed to advocating for favorable outcomes for fans.
